Inside Catalina Foothills Arizona’s Housing Shortage: Causes, Solutions, and What It Means for Buyers and Sellers

The Catalina Foothills, one of Tucson’s most prestigious communities, is known for its luxury homes, breathtaking views of the Santa Catalina Mountains, and proximity to top schools, shopping, and golf courses. But with its reputation as a highly desirable place to live, the Catalina Foothills faces a housing shortage that is changing the way buyers and sellers approach the market.


The Causes of Catalina Foothills’ Housing Shortage

  1. High Demand for Luxury Living
    The Catalina Foothills attracts retirees, families, and professionals looking for upscale properties in a serene desert setting. This constant demand keeps inventory tight.

  2. Limited Land for Development
    Much of the Foothills is built out, with limited land available for new large-scale developments. Strict zoning and a focus on preserving natural desert landscapes further limit construction.

  3. Low Turnover Rates
    Many homeowners in the Foothills hold onto their properties long-term, reducing the number of available listings.

  4. Rising Home Prices
    With limited supply and high demand, home prices in the Catalina Foothills have risen significantly, making it more competitive for buyers.


Possible Solutions in the Catalina Foothills

  • Infill Development: Redevelopment of underused parcels of land may provide additional housing options.

  • High-End Remodeling: Updating existing homes to meet current demand helps keep inventory appealing.

  • Creative Housing Approaches: Some developers are exploring smaller-scale projects to bring more homes into the market.


What This Means for Buyers

  • Luxury Market Competition: Homes in the Catalina Foothills often receive multiple offers, especially those with mountain views or luxury amenities.

  • Higher Price Points: Buyers should be prepared for premium pricing compared to surrounding areas.

  • Preparedness is Key: Pre-approval and working with a Realtor experienced in luxury real estate is essential.


What This Means for Sellers

  • Strong Advantage: Sellers are in a prime position, as demand for Catalina Foothills homes continues to outpace supply.

  • Faster Sales: Many listings move quickly, particularly well-maintained or remodeled properties.

  • Maximizing Value: Sellers can often achieve top dollar, sometimes above asking price.
